Feeling Untouchable

Feeling untouchable is an emotional sensation or a particular state of mind that is beyond attack or criticism of any sort. It is a kind of moral sensitivity especially in relation to personal principles or dignity that is immuned to certain attacks or criticisms.

Criticisms are bound to occur in almost every setting or aspect of the human race because humans would always be humans. Nothing ever satisfy us. Our wants are unlimited and insatiable. Criticisms are in various shapes and levels, but beyond criticism, there is a higher life which is the life of the "Untouchable". To attain this height, you must have gone through certain processes as well as imbibe certain virtues. It is these virtues that enable you build tough skin over certain criticisms. Anyone who is waiting to have a smooth ride without criticism is not ready to grow. It is these criticisms and the ability to manage them without losing yourself that makes you stand out (untouchable).
